The BRCU course is approximately 15 hours of classroom and on-cycle instruction conducted over a two-day session. Prior to the first day of class, an online e-course must be completed and a certificate of completion must be presented at the start of the first day.
The Classroom time consists of approximately 5 hours of Rider Coach-led discussions and student interactive activities. The On-cycle exercises will provide basic techniques and street strategies including straight-line riding, defensive maneuvering, turning, shifting, and braking to help you in everyday situations. Attendance for all sessions is mandatory and successful completion of both the written exam and on-cycle evaluation is required to receive your MSB-8 completion card.
